You come here to play with cats. However, the playfulness of the cats can vary. Most are around 1 year old, however they get so much attention, they are not always interested in playing. Still, if you wait a little, they can change their minds. Some of the cats (but not all) are up for adoption. They probably would appreciate a quieter home too. There is also food and tea.

It's a nice idea, but I don't think it really works in practice. The cats are getting a new round of strangers every hour or so, and must be fairly bored of them by now. The most aggressive humans will exhaust the patience of the average cat, leaving the rest of the humans unable to build any trust with the cats. Some are inured to the contact and lay there, perhaps enjoying it, but certainly not expressing active interest. It's hard to tell if they're just putting up with it. I'm pretty sure you can get a superior cat experience by just visiting a friend with housecats once in a while.
